President Donald Trump thanked Morocco's King Mohammed VI for naming a major highway after him, according to Abu Ali Express. The highway, reportedly over 1,000 kilometers long, is located in the eastern Sahara. Trump wrote that he would be happy to travel its entire length. The expression of gratitude comes amid a series of Trump statements on regional diplomacy and Middle Eastern relations.
